The In-Cabin Small Dog Option

With this option you can bring your small dog into the cabin when it is confined in an approved soft-sided pet carrier and stowed beneath the seat in front of you. The fee for this service is $100 each way.

Midwest wants to ensure the comfort of all passengers on each flight. To help you understand our rules and your responsibility when traveling with your small dog, we request you read and carefully follow our Pet Policy and Procedures.

Basic Rules for In-Cabin Small Dog Travel on Midwest Airlines
Please print this sheet, review it before travel and carry it with you.

  • Small Dogs Only. Must fit in medium soft-sided carrier (11" high x 18" long), stowed under seat.
  • Midwest Airlines-Approved Carrier A Midwest Airlines-approved carrier must be used. Available for purchase on midwestairlines.com.
  • Dog Must Stay Completely in Carrier at All Times. All parts of the dog (head, nose, paws, tail, ears) must stay completely inside the carrier at all times in the airport, airport areas and on the aircraft. No body parts may protrude from the carrier.
  • Precious Cargo Tag. Ensure that your tag — given to you at the ticket counter upon check-in — is complete, dated and visible for the flight attendants to verify.
  • Vet Health Certificate. Upon check-in, you must present a veterinarian health certificate that includes current vaccination records and is dated within 10 days of travel.
  • Well-Behaved Dogs Only. Disruption of other passengers is not acceptable. It is your responsibility to quiet your dog without removing it from the carrier and without permitting any body parts to protrude from the carrier.
  • Exercise Before Airport Arrival. Take the time to exercise your dog before arriving at the airport. Pack proper clean-up and disposal materials in your carry-on, as it your responsibility to immediately clean up any pet accidents — without removing your dog from the carrier.
  • Seating. For safety reasons, passengers traveling with in-cabin dogs are not allowed to sit in exit row or bulkhead seats.
  • Please Follow These Rules. If you or your pet disregard or violate any rule or direction given by a crew member, you will not be able to travel with your pet in the cabin on future Midwest flights.
